What does an Entry Level Oracle Financial Analyst do?

An Entry Level Oracle Financial Analyst assists with the implementation, maintenance, and optimization of Oracle Financials software within an organization. They help analyze financial data, generate reports, and support end users in navigating the Oracle Financials system. Their role often involves troubleshooting issues, documenting processes, and collaborating with finance and IT teams to ensure accurate financial management. This position is ideal for those looking to gain experience in both finance and technology.

What types of projects and tasks can I expect to work on as an Entry Level Oracle Financial Analyst?

As an Entry Level Oracle Financial Analyst, you'll primarily assist with the implementation, configuration, and support of Oracle Financials modules such as Accounts Payable, General Ledger, and Fixed Assets. Your daily tasks may include data analysis, generating financial reports, troubleshooting system issues, and supporting end-users with their inquiries. You'll often collaborate with senior analysts, IT teams, and finance departments to ensure smooth financial operations and may participate in testing new system features or upgrades. This role offers a great foundation for developing technical and business skills in the financial systems domain.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level Oracle Financial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Oracle Financial Analyst, you need a solid understanding of financial principles, analytical thinking, and a b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, or a related field. Familiarity with Oracle Financials ERP software, Microsoft Excel, and basic data analysis tools is typically required. Strong attention to detail, effective communication, and problem-solving abilities help you stand out in this role. These skills are crucial for accurately analyzing financial data, supporting business decisions, and ensuring the integrity of financial processes within an organization.

Program Financial Analyst / Tool SME (Deltek Cobra, Oracle, and/or Microsoft tool-sets)
Role Description & Responsibilities:
  • Position will require client travel at least 50% of the time.
  • Oversight of program Earned Value Management Systems(EVMS) for tracking program compliance, schedule and cost performance
  • Responsible for preparing, analyzing and reviewing program performance measurement and cost variances.
  • Provide cost control and financial support for program management and program cost control managers.
  • Prepare monthly CPR Formats 1-5 or IPMR deliverables
  • Supports customer audits and reviews. Communicates with DCMA on a regular basis regarding EVMS assessments.
  • Track and manage program Post and Copy billings and cash collections.
  • Generate and analyze quarterly program Estimates at Complete (EACs) in accordance with Corporate policies.
  • Work independently to identify solutions and provide strategic direction in a dynamic ambiguous & environment.
  • Support management reviews and audits on a monthly and quarterly basis consisting of operations, planning, program management and EAC reviews.

Experience Requirements:
  • Expert with required tool-set (Deltek Cobra, Oracle, and/or Microsoft tool-sets).
  • Experience with US government cost-reimbursement contracts and Federal Acquisition Regulations (FAR).
  • Experience in implementing Earned Value Management Systems (EVMS) and baseline development.
  • PC proficiency including MS Excel, Word, PowerPoint and Outlook.
  • Thorough knowledge and application of accounting principles, Earned Value Management, scheduling, proposal process, government financial reporting with general knowledge of government contracts and procurement regulations.
  • US Citizenship required. DoD Security Clearance (Preferred)
